Nidhi Tewari, a 2014-batch IFS officer, has been appointed as Prime Minister Narendra Modi's new private secretary, succeeding Vivek Kumar and Hardik Shah. Tewari, who played a key role in India's G20 chairmanship, currently serves as Deputy Secretary in the Prime Minister's Office.
